Today I Danced

Today as I danced, the woman behind me sobbed, grieving the husband who died last week, and I realized I’ve become less comfortable with my own public tears.

Today as I danced, I touched the spirits of ancestors and children waiting to be born.

Today as I danced I felt my power, my softness, my ache.

Today, I danced.

Grateful.

Alive.
